About the Item

A French console chest with tambour doors and its original marble top, from the early 20th century. This antique chest from France features the original rectangular-shaped marble top (with rounded front corners) which rests atop a case which houses two reed-carved front doors flanked within rounded side posts that are adorn with brass outlined trim and decorative brass embellishments. The skirting has a clean molding and softly rounded corners which carry the them from the upper case and marble. This piece is presented upon six bulb style feet with gold toned egg-n-dart moldings about their upper perimeters. Please note that there have been some prior repairs to one of the feet, as well as the backside of the marble top (see additional images). This early 20th century server console with original marble top, brass accents, and reeded tambour doors is just over 6 feet in length.
  • Dimensions:
    Height: 41.25 in (104.78 cm)Width: 72.75 in (184.79 cm)Depth: 15.5 in (39.37 cm)
